Introduction to Small Pitch LED Displays in Nightlife Venues

The modern bar and nightclub environment demands visual experiences that captivate patrons and create immersive atmospheres. Traditional projection systems and large-format LCD screens often fall short in high-ambient-light conditions or when dynamic, high-resolution content is required. Small pitch LED display technology has emerged as the definitive solution for these venues, offering unparalleled brightness, seamless image quality, and flexible installation geometries. By utilizing pixel pitches of 2.5mm or smaller, these displays deliver sharp, vibrant visuals even from close viewing distances typical of crowded dance floors and VIP lounges. For nightclub owners and operators, investing in a small pitch LED wall is not merely an aesthetic choice but a strategic move to increase dwell time, enhance brand identity, and drive revenue through engaging visual content.

Unlike standard outdoor or large-pitch indoor LED screens, small pitch variants are engineered specifically for interior environments where viewers are often less than three meters from the screen. This proximity demands a much higher pixel density to eliminate the visible grid effect that plagues larger pitch displays. A typical small pitch LED panel used in bars and nightclubs might feature a 1.2mm or 1.5mm pixel pitch, providing a resolution density that rivals high-end digital signage. Furthermore, these systems are designed to operate reliably in environments with variable temperatures, humidity from crowds, and occasional smoke or haze machines, making robust engineering a critical consideration for any manufacturer or installer.

Pixel Pitch, Resolution, and Viewing Distance Considerations

The selection of an appropriate pixel pitch is the most critical technical decision when deploying an LED display in a bar or nightclub. Pixel pitch, measured in millimeters, defines the distance between the center of one pixel to the center of the adjacent pixel. For nightlife venues, common pixel pitches range from 0.9mm to 2.5mm, with the optimal choice determined by the minimum viewing distance. A rule of thumb in the industry is that the viewing distance in meters should be at least equal to the pixel pitch value multiplied by 1000. For instance, a 1.5mm pitch display is best viewed from approximately 1.5 meters or further, while a 2.5mm pitch screen requires a minimum distance of about 2.5 meters for optimal visual blending.

Resolution is directly tied to pixel pitch and screen size. A 1.2mm pitch LED panel offers significantly higher pixel density than a 2.5mm panel of the same physical dimensions. For a standard 500mm x 500mm cabinet, a 1.2mm pitch configuration delivers approximately 416 x 416 pixels, resulting in a total of over 173,000 pixels per cabinet. In contrast, a 2.5mm pitch cabinet of the same size provides only 200 x 200 pixels, or 40,000 pixels per cabinet. For a large video wall composed of multiple cabinets, this difference translates into dramatically sharper text, smoother motion, and more detailed video content. Nightclubs that display live camera feeds, high-definition music videos, or intricate motion graphics benefit immensely from sub-2mm pitches, as these applications demand high pixel density to avoid visible pixelation at typical dance floor distances.

Brightness, Contrast, and Ambient Light Management

One of the primary advantages of small pitch LED displays in bars and nightclubs is their ability to deliver exceptionally high brightness levels without sacrificing color accuracy or contrast. While typical indoor commercial displays might operate at 500 to 700 nits, small pitch LED panels designed for nightlife environments often achieve brightness levels between 1000 and 2000 nits. This capability is essential for overcoming the ambient light from stage lighting, DJ consoles, and architectural illumination that is prevalent in these spaces. A brightness of at least 1200 nits is recommended for venues with moderate to high ambient light, ensuring that content remains vivid and readable even when spotlights sweep across the screen.

Contrast ratio is equally important for creating deep blacks and rich colors that define the immersive nightclub aesthetic. Modern small pitch LED displays utilize black surface treatment technologies, such as black encapsulation or black matrix coating, which absorb ambient light and minimize reflections. These technologies enable static contrast ratios exceeding 5000:1, producing true black levels that make colors appear more saturated and dynamic. Additionally, many small pitch panels incorporate high dynamic range (HDR) processing, which enhances the perceptual contrast by optimizing brightness across different zones of the image. For nightclub operators, this means that dark, moody visuals remain atmospheric without becoming muddy, while bright strobes and neon effects pop with intensity.

Refresh Rate, Scan Rate, and Visual Performance

In a nightclub environment, where cameras are frequently used for live streaming or recording, the refresh rate of an LED display becomes a critical specification. Standard LED displays often operate at 60Hz or 120Hz, but professional small pitch panels for bars and nightclubs typically support refresh rates of 1920Hz, 3840Hz, or even higher. A high refresh rate eliminates visible flicker, which is particularly noticeable when the screen is captured on camera or when patrons view the display with peripheral vision during fast-paced motion. For video content with rapid cuts, strobe effects, or fast-moving visuals, a refresh rate of 3840Hz ensures smooth playback and reduces eye strain for viewers over extended periods.

The scan rate, often expressed as 1/16, 1/24, or 1/32 scan, determines how many rows of LEDs are driven simultaneously within each refresh cycle. Lower scan rates, such as 1/32, are common in small pitch displays because they allow for finer pixel pitches and better current distribution. However, lower scan rates can sometimes introduce visible scan lines or reduced brightness if not properly engineered. Premium small pitch LED panels for nightlife use employ advanced driver ICs with features like high grayscale resolution (16-bit or higher) and dynamic current control. These components ensure that even at low scan rates, the display maintains uniform brightness, smooth gradients, and accurate color reproduction across the entire video wall, regardless of content complexity.

Durability, IP Rating, and Environmental Resistance

Bars and nightclubs present unique environmental challenges that demand robust display construction. Unlike controlled office environments, nightlife venues experience temperature fluctuations, high humidity from crowds, airborne particulates from fog machines, and occasional liquid splashes near bar areas. Small pitch LED displays intended for these applications should carry an appropriate Ingress Protection (IP) rating. For indoor installations, an IP40 or IP54 rating on the front of the panel is common, providing protection against dust ingress and splashing water. However, some manufacturers offer higher-rated front serviceable panels with IP65 front protection for installations directly above dance floors or near DJ booths where liquid exposure is more likely.

Thermal management is another crucial aspect of durability. LED panels generate significant heat, especially when running at high brightness levels for extended hours. Quality small pitch displays incorporate die-cast aluminum cabinets with integrated heat sinks and intelligent fan cooling systems. These designs maintain junction temperatures within safe operating limits, preventing color shift, premature LED degradation, or catastrophic failure. Power consumption is also a practical consideration for venue operators. A typical small pitch LED wall might draw between 150 and 300 watts per square meter at maximum brightness, with an average power draw of 50 to 100 watts per square meter during typical content playback. Efficient power supply units with power factor correction (PFC) help reduce operational costs and minimize heat output, contributing to a longer lifespan for the display and lower air conditioning loads in the venue.

Installation, Calibration, and Maintenance Considerations

The physical installation of a small pitch LED wall in a bar or nightclub requires careful planning to accommodate both aesthetic and structural requirements. These displays are often mounted on curved walls, suspended from ceilings, or integrated into architectural features such as columns or stage backdrops. Modular cabinet designs, typically 500mm x 500mm or 600mm x 337.5mm, allow for flexible configurations, including concave or convex curves with minimal visible seams. For seamless visual integration, the cabinets must be precisely aligned using laser-based calibration tools, and the gap between cabinets should be less than 0.1mm to prevent visible dark lines or light leaks.

Calibration is an ongoing requirement for maintaining uniform color and brightness across the entire video wall. Factory calibration ensures that each cabinet meets specifications for color temperature (typically 6500K) and gamma, but field calibration using automated camera systems is recommended after installation and periodically thereafter. Many professional small pitch LED systems support real-time calibration via software that adjusts individual pixel brightness and color values, compensating for LED aging and environmental variations. Maintenance accessibility is another key factor. Front-serviceable panels allow technicians to replace individual LED modules or power supplies without removing the entire display from the wall, minimizing downtime during operational hours. For nightclubs that operate late into the night, this design feature is invaluable, as repairs can be performed quickly between opening hours without disrupting the venue layout or requiring heavy equipment.

The viewing angle of an LED display determines how well the image can be seen from different positions. High-quality LED screens offer viewing angles of 160° horizontal and 140° vertical, ensuring consistent color and brightness across a wide area. This is particularly important for large-scale installations in stadiums and public spaces.

Transparent LED Displays Transform Architecture

Transparent LED displays are gaining popularity in commercial architecture, offering up to 85% transparency while displaying vivid content. These innovative screens are being installed in shopping mall facades, airport terminals, and luxury retail stores, allowing natural light to pass through while delivering digital content. The technology eliminates the need to choose between windows and screens.

Virtual Production Studios Drive LED Demand

The film and television industry is rapidly adopting LED volume stages for virtual production, following the success of productions like The Mandalorian. These massive curved LED walls create photorealistic backgrounds in real-time, reducing the need for on-location shooting and green screen compositing. The virtual production LED market is expected to grow by 35% annually through 2028.
